The beta version of Grimrock 2 for Mac is out! To opt into the beta, do the following:
1) right-click on Legend of Grimrock 2 in your Steam client, choose Properties. If Legend of Grimrock 2 is not shown in your games library, choose "Games" from the drop-down above the library view to display all your games, not just Mac games.
2) choose "mac_beta2" from the betas dropdown
3) the game should now download
If you have problems downloading the game, restarting the Steam client usually helps.

Requirements:
- OS: Mac OS X 10.7.5 or later
- Processor: 1.4 GHz dual-core Intel Core i5 processor minimum, 2.5 GHz or better recommended
- Memory: 2 GB RAM minimum (may require lowering texture resolution), 4 GB or more recommended
- Graphics: OpenGL 3.2 capable graphics card, Intel HD Graphics 5000 minimum, Geforce GT 650M or better recommended
- Hard Drive: 2 GB available space
Known issues:
- the initial Steam overlay pop up may appear in file dialogs and may crash the Dungeon Editor. This is an issue with the Steam overlay renderer with no workaround.
Release notes for 2.2.3:
- optimized CPU usage of shadow rendering
- optimized water rendering
- added touchscreen mode to game options
- improved dynamic lighting when using low quality rendering mode
- removed draw distance from graphics options
- added new hidden graphics option maxDrawDistance to grimrock.cfg
- added support for drawing portraits using the gui context
- added new scripting function: Champion:resetExp()
- added new scripting hooks: Party.onGetPortrait() and BombItem.onExplode()
- textboxes now use OS X keyboard shortcuts (cmd-c, etc.)
- bug fix: click zones of menu options in main menu and pause menu are slightly off
Release notes for 2.2.2:
- optimized rendering of trees
- bug fix: cursor is visible during loading screens and cinematics
- bug fix: screen flashes white when starting up the game
- bug fix: crash when window close button is clicked on
- bug fix: tree leaves have dark spots on OpenGL
- bug fix: fog particles are too bright on OpenGL
- bug fix: pointlights are not reflected in water on OpenGL
- bug fix: title music does not play during loading screen
Release notes for 2.2.1:
- optimized CPU usage of the graphics engine
- added draw distance to graphics options
- optimized input latency especially when frame rate drops below 60 fps
- bug fix: tomb of guardians puzzle could end up in an incorrect state
- bug fix: projectiles don't pass through open cemetery gate
- bug fix: a monster standing in a monster blocker square can't be melee attacked
- bug fix: skeleton archers can be poisoned
- bug fix: projectiles stuck in a fire elemental are lost when the elemental hits the party and explodes
- bug fix: snakes inside force fields can be hit with projectiles
- bug fix: knockback can move the party while falling
- bug fix: spell panel remains open when using bare hands to cast and items are equipped into mage's hands
- bug fix: loot dropped by monsters is sometimes (very rarely) spawned in wrong square
- bug fix: non-stackable throwing items stack when auto-picked up
- bug fix: removed "invisible" energy potion in shipwreck beach
- bug fix: FirearmAttackComponent:setBaseDamageStats() has an incorrect argument type
- bug fix: ProjectileComponent:setCastByChampion() has an incorrect argument type
- bug fix: MaterialEx:setTexture() does not work for standard textures (diffuseMap, specularMap, normalMap, emissiveMap)
- bug fix: calling setDoorState() after the level has been loaded does not work
- video *.ivf files add now automatically exported to mods
- added new scripting functions: Map:getLevel(), ItemComponent:throwItem(dir, power), ItemComponent:land(), Component:getName(), Component:getClass()
